Danube hits sell-out on first day itself

Off-plan projects with property values seen as being accessible are finding no dearth of buyers in Dubai. The Danube Group’s first venture into real estate development, a cluster of 171 town houses in the Al Furjan community being built for Dh500 million, was sold out on the first day itself.

Tamouh receives working capital facility from Mashreq

Abu Dhabi-based real estate developer Tamouh Investments, which is responsible for developing 60% of the Reem Island’s master plan, signed a working capital facility with Mashreq Bank. The funding aims to ensure sufficient cash flow for Tamouh’s working capital requirements.
